What is Yammer?
Microsoft Yammer is the industry-defining social network for the enterprise. Millions of employees, including 85% of Fortune 500 companies use Yammer every day, to build community and culture, share knowledge, and connect with their leaders and each other.
Why Yammer?
Yammer was one of the first startup unicorns this past decade and was acquired by Microsoft in 2012. About this job
Our backend engineers develop the core Yammer services that power all our experiences. As a social networking product, Yammer has tons of interesting engineering challenges - like supporting large-scale conversations with hundreds of thousands of participants. We deploy new code every day to our tens of millions of users and are constantly innovating to improve the system and deliver a delightful experience.
Our BE stack:
Linux on Azure
Java and Ruby micro services, deployed as docker containers
Graph QL, DropWizard, Rails REST APIs
Postgres/CosmosDB/Kafka/RabbitMQ/Redis storage and queuing
Mesos container orchestration, HAProxy-based service mesh
Wavefront metrics, Azure Data Explorer log aggregation, PagerDuty alerting
